The Exocoetus : PNG Frontier Surfaris Charter

Exocoetus Skipper

Name: Andrew Rigby

Nickname: "Undies"

Age: 28

Qualifications: Skipper & Tradesman

Background:

Andrew is from a family of five generations of fishermen from Port Philip Bay and Bass Strait in Victoria. A qualified skipper and engineering tradesperson he has spent many years on the water aboard trawlers, long liners, charter vessels and living on his own yacht for two years sailing up and down the East Coast of Oz.

Andrew spent grommet hood growing up surfing at 13th beach on Victoria’s South-coast. He’s a mad keen surfer and finding these epic waves in PNG has given him the buzz for surf exploration and charters.

Years in PNG:

Andrew first set foot on terra firma in PNG in February 2005. After a delightful motor on the “Exocoetus” across the Coral Sea hanging out with Cyclone Ingrid! He worked the boat as a lobster-trading vessel for under a year, all the while discovering and surfing a goldmine of wave potential. Thankfully the trading didn’t prove to be a fruitful exercise, so Andrew decided to pursue a more sustainable water activity with surfing charters. An awesome opportunity for a husband and wife duo…and a lifelong dream for Andrew.
